Serum PCB Concentrations and Cochlear Function in 12-Year-Old Children

Abstract: Experimental evidence from animals indicates that exposure to polychlorinated biphenyls (PCBs) causes deterioration of the outer hair cells (OHCs) of the cochlea. To test this hypothesis in humans, we measured serum PCB concentrations in 574 12-year-old children residing in three districts in the Slovak Republic using high-resolution gas chromatography with micro-electron capture detection. “…In other hand, in San Felipe Nuevo Mercurio, Zacatecas, Mexico, the mean levels found in children living in that community was 1,600 ng/g lipid (Costilla-Salazar et al 2011). When compared PCBs levels in blood found in this study with levels reported in others studies around the world, we can note that children living in El Ramonal had higher levels (5,892.1 ng/g lipid) than children living in China (40.6 ng/g lipid; Shen et al 2010) and children living in the Slovak Republic (352.8 ng/g lipid; Trnovec et al 2010).…”

“…Impairments in auditory function are a consistent finding in human and rodent models examining effects of developmental PCBs (Jusko et al, 2014; Trnovec et al, 2010; Powers et al, 2006, 2009; Poon et al, 2011). Previously, our lab has reported that auditory brainstem response (ABR) thresholds were elevated across all frequencies tested in PCB-exposed rats, indicative of dysfunction in the cochlea or auditory nerve (Powers et al, 2006).…”
